Article Optics

Cr:ZnS-based soliton self-frequency shifted signal generation for a tunable sub-100 fs MWIR OPCPA

Pia Fuertjes et al.

Summary: We present a tunable, high-energy optical parametric chirped pulse amplification system with a front-end based on a femtosecond Cr:ZnS laser. The system uses the broad emission spectrum of the femtosecond Cr:ZnS master oscillator for direct seeding the pump and Raman self-frequency shifting for generating the signal pulses. The tunable idler pulses generated in fluoride fiber have a wavelength range of 2.8-3.2 μm.

Article Optics

Highly efficient THz generation by optical rectification of mid-IR pulses in DAST

Claudia Gollner et al.

Summary: Efficient THz generation in DAST is achieved through optical rectification of intense mid-IR pulses at 3.9 µm and its second harmonic at 1.95 µm. The high optical-to-THz conversion efficiency is attributed to resonantly enhanced nonlinearity and advantageous phase matching of THz and driving pulse velocities. The low linear and multi-photon absorption at 1.95 µm, combined with cascaded optical rectification, leads to record optical-to-THz conversion efficiencies nearing 6%.
